Comprehending Cold Laser Therapy



Cold laser treatment, typically made use of for handling arthritis pain, is a non-invasive therapy that makes use of low-level lasers or light-emitting diodes (LEDs) to advertise healing and reduce inflammation.

This treatment functions by supplying details wavelengths of light to the impacted locations, promoting mobile function and boosting cells repair service.

When you undertake cold laser therapy, you won't feel any kind of discomfort or pain. Instead, you may see a mild heat as the laser permeates your skin. The therapy commonly lasts in between 5 to 30 minutes, depending on the extent of your condition and the area being dealt with.


Among the excellent things about cold laser treatment is its convenience; it can target different types of arthritis and can be integrated with various other treatments to make best use of benefits.

It's also appropriate for individuals of every ages, making it a popular option for those looking for relief without invasive procedures or drugs.

Prospective Benefits and Limitations



When thinking about cold laser treatment for joint inflammation pain, you may find a variety of prospective advantages and restrictions. One significant advantage is that it's a non-invasive therapy alternative, which implies you will not need to take care of the adverse effects that come from medications or surgical procedures.

Several patients report minimized discomfort and swelling after sessions, enhancing their movement and general lifestyle. Moreover, cold laser therapy can be combined with various other therapies, providing a more extensive strategy to taking care of joint inflammation.

Nonetheless, it's vital to recognize the restrictions too. While click for more support its performance, others show blended outcomes, suggesting that it may not benefit everyone.

The cost of several sessions can add up, and insurance policy coverage differs, making it an economic consideration. Furthermore, you could require to dedicate to a series of treatments to see substantial renovations, which can be taxing.

Ultimately, considering these possible benefits and constraints can help you make an informed decision concerning whether cold laser therapy is the right fit for your joint inflammation administration strategy.
